Key Components for That Signature Bang Bang Sauce
Protein Base:
Chicken Breast: Lean meat that provides the main protein, best when fresh and free from tough spots.
Egg: Helps bind the coating and adds richness to the chicken.
Coating Dry Ingredients:
Panko Breadcrumbs: Light and crispy Japanese-style breadcrumbs that create a crunchy exterior.
All-Purpose Flour, Cornstarch: Provides a base for the crispy coating and helps achieve golden color.
Onion Powder, Kosher Salt, Black Pepper, Chili Powder: Seasonings that add depth and subtle heat to the chicken's coating.
Liquid and Sauce Ingredients:
Buttermilk: Tenderizes the chicken and helps the coating stick.
Vegetable Oil: Neutral oil perfect for deep frying at high temperatures.
Mayonnaise, Sweet Chili Sauce, Hot Sauce, Honey, Rice Wine Vinegar: Create a tangy, sweet, and spicy dipping sauce with complex flavor profile.
Cooking Guide: From Marinating to Serving
Step 1: Prepare Zesty Sauce
Mayonnaise
Sweet chili sauce
Hot sauce
Honey
Rice wine vinegar
Whisk all ingredients in a small bowl until silky smooth. Set aside while preparing other components.
Step 2: Create Flavor-Packed Batter
All-purpose flour
Cornstarch
Onion powder
Salt
Black pepper
Chili powder
Buttermilk
Egg
Hot sauce
Combine dry ingredients in a medium bowl. Gradually mix in wet ingredients, whisking until the batter becomes perfectly smooth and lump-free.
Step 3: Coat Chicken Pieces
Dunk chicken chunks into the prepared batter, ensuring each piece is completely and evenly covered with the flavorful mixture.
Step 4: Set Up Frying Station
Heat vegetable oil in a large, heavy-bottomed skillet to 325°F (163°C). Use a deep-fry thermometer to check the precise temperature for perfect crispiness.
Step 5: Bread and Crisp Chicken
Panko breadcrumbs
Pour breadcrumbs into a shallow dish. Remove battered chicken pieces, letting excess batter drip off. Roll each piece in breadcrumbs, creating a crunchy exterior.
Step 6: Fry to Golden Perfection
Carefully place breaded chicken into hot oil. Fry in small batches for 3-4 minutes until they turn a beautiful golden brown and become irresistibly crispy.
Step 7: Drain Excess Oil
Transfer fried chicken to a paper towel-lined plate. Allow excess oil to drain, keeping the chicken wonderfully crisp.
Step 8: Serve with Spectacular Sauce
Drizzle the prepared sauce over the chicken or serve on the side for dipping. Garnish with chopped green onions or sesame seeds if desired.
Pro Chef Tips to Amp Up the Heat and Flavor
Maintain Oil Temperature: Keep the oil consistently around 325°F for perfectly crispy chicken without burning the exterior.
Drain Excess Batter: Shake off extra batter before coating with breadcrumbs to prevent soggy or clumpy chicken pieces.
Use Fresh Buttermilk: Choose fresh buttermilk for a tangier, more tender chicken that absorbs flavors more effectively.
Prevent Overcrowding: Fry chicken in small batches to ensure each piece gets crispy and cooks evenly without dropping the oil temperature.
Rest Before Serving: Let fried chicken sit on paper towels for 2-3 minutes to allow excess oil to drain and maintain maximum crispiness.
Keeping Your Chicken Tender: Storage & Reheat Tips
Refrigeration: Store cooled Bang Bang Chicken in an airtight container within 2 hours of cooking. Keep refrigerated for up to 3-4 days to maintain freshness and prevent bacterial growth.
Reheating Oven: Preheat oven to 375°F. Place chicken on a wire rack over a baking sheet to help retain crispiness. Warm for 10-12 minutes, flipping halfway through to ensure even heating and restore original crunch.
Microwave Alternative: While not ideal for maintaining crispiness, microwave chicken in 30-second intervals, checking temperature and texture. Add a paper towel to absorb moisture and prevent sogginess. Best used when you're short on time and want a quick meal.

Experiment with Flavors: Bang Bang Chicken Variations
Spicy Korean Kick: Replace hot sauce with gochujang for an authentic Korean flavor profile, adding extra red pepper flakes for more heat and depth.
Mediterranean Herb Crunch: Swap breadcrumbs with crushed za'atar-seasoned crackers, incorporating fresh oregano and lemon zest into the batter for a Mediterranean-inspired variation.
Coconut Caribbean Style: Substitute some flour with shredded coconut in the batter, mix pineapple juice into the sauce, and add a touch of rum for a tropical Caribbean flair.
Gluten-Free Crispy Option: Use almond flour and gluten-free cornstarch for the batter, swap panko with crushed gluten-free rice crackers to create a celiac-friendly version that doesn't compromise on crunchiness.
